How We Calibrated Difficulty

Easy

Single-step. Direct application of one concept. The kind of question a well-prepared student should answer confidently in under a minute.

Medium

Two steps or two concepts combined. Requires interpretation, a word problem, or careful reading. Roughly half of test-takers get these right.

Hard

Multi-step reasoning, parameter finding, subtle grammar distinctions, or inference across two texts. These are the questions that separate top scorers.
